Board reviews proposal for Security Systems & Integration Specialist role

Clifton ISD Board of Trustees · February 23, 2026

Superintendent Andy Ball and CISD Technology Director Barbi Ernst described a proposed Security Systems & Integration Specialist position to serve as the primary coordinator for the district’s surveillance system of more than 200 cameras, mandated emergency alert technologies, integrated building systems (including card readers), and to assist staff in using instructional technology.

Ball said he and Ernst began discussing the role while preparing the Cybersecurity Annex to the Emergency Operations Plan and that the board would consider adding the position at its March meeting. No motion or vote was recorded at this meeting; trustees were presented with the proposal for future consideration.
